Dear Newmarket parents, guardians, teachers, students, and community members,


I want to highlight a couple of civic engagement opportunities in Newmarket over the next week.


Tuesday, March 12th, is election day in Newmarket. Voting will be at the Town Hall Auditorium from 7:00 AM to 7:00 PM. All town and school district warrant articles will be voted on. More information on the elections can be found on the town and school district websites. Here is a link to a quick reference budget flier regarding the school district warrant. 


Another great opportunity to participate in town decision-making is Saturday, March 16th. The Town of Newmarket, with its partner Strafford Regional Planning Commission, is hosting a Master Plan Visioning session at Newmarket Junior/Senior High School from 8:30 AM – 12:00 PM. At this workshop, a community vision will be developed that will assist the town in how to concentrate its planning efforts for the next 5 to 10 years. There will also be chances to discuss housing issues and opportunities to engage in conversations related to planning for open space (improvement of conservation lands, outdoor recreation opportunities, and preservation of land and water resources) advancement.
